The dialysis catheter will … WebPort removal is faster than placement. You shouldn’t need anesthesia. You may want to take NSAIDs afterward if you have pain. Your provider: Applies numbing cream to the skin. Makes a small incision in the skin at the port site. Gently pulls on the catheter to dislodge it from the vein. Removes the port and catheter through the incision.
